Get started35 Alexandra Road is a four-bedroom mid-terrace house in Newham, London, London (E6 6HA). It has a recorded floor area of 106 m² (around 1141 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(June 2012)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since November 2009.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and main heating d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from June 2012,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
It hasn't traded since June 2010, a hold of 16 years that's notably long for the area. Sale prices here have outpaced London HPI: 12.2%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£428,000 sits 94.5% above the 2010 sale of £220,000. At 106 m² the property is well over the postcode median (81 m² across 27 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ock.
